Intellectual Property

Our team has significant expertise in dealing with matters pertaining to intellectual properties including trademarks, certification and rectification of trademarks, patents, copy rights and registered designs and trade secrets.

As a matter of fact, piracy is on rise especially in third world countries, which not only affects the business of commercial entities but also the interest and feelings of individual persons. Laws of land provide the protection of rights of such entities and individuals against the stealth of what originally is an innovation of their own hectic efforts and design of their creativity. In addition, we deal in litigation involved in these areas by lodging the First Information Report (FIR) with the concerned Police, against those culprits who indulge in using false trademarks, false property marks, counterfeiting trade and property marks, selling counterfeit goods, making of false mark upon a receptacle containing goods, tempering with property mark etc. We also conduct litigation concerning disputes of the intangible properties including questions of ownership, validity, infringement, and misappropriation.
